Lester is a boy name.
Pronunciation: American English /ˈlɛs.təɹ/; British English /ˈlɛs.tə/.
Meaning and history
From an English surname that was derived from the name of the city of Leicester, originally denoting a person who was from that place. The city's name is derived from the river name Ligore combined with Latin castra "camp".
